Bentos are known as a way to pack lunches with a fun twist. They especially have become quite popular amongst kids, as a way to enjoy and eat healthier foods. If food looks fun or interesting to a kid, then they’re more likely to eat it, no matter what it is. Bento boxes are also a neater way to pack a bunch of food into one container. Another benefit is that bento lunch boxes provide portion control, which is definitely a better way to eat!

There are many bento lunch boxes to choose from. The art of bento lunch boxing is quite easy, but requires planning ahead.

By using mini muffin silicone baking cups, add different types of fruits or veggies within each one and place them in a bento box! You’ll have a variety of food to eat, and the idea of different food won’t make you dread eating it! Some ideas of what kind of food to add could be grapes, meatballs, mashed potatoes, mixed veggies like corn and peas, and even pasta!

Bento lunches are fun, and totally customizable. You can use leftovers from the night before or create entirely new meals. The possibilities are totally endless with creativity when using bento lunch boxes!

A Bento Lunch Box is a lunch box with smaller containers within. With usually 3-4 smaller boxes, this is a great way to portion control your meals. This helps to prevent overeating, resulting in gaining weight. Also, the containers in bento lunch boxes are reusable, reducing use of plastic bags and paper bags.

Adding food in the bento boxes does require a lot of planning, but it isn’t too bad, considering that you will save more money in the long run by packing a lunch everyday. You can also use last night’s dinner leftovers. Just remember, when you pack a bento lunch, you need to make sure that the food will fit in the box, and close properly. No one likes an overstuffed bento box!

A good rule of thumb is to add your entrée in the bigger bento box, with your side in a smaller box, followed by a snack such as fruit or baked good in the smaller box. That way, you have a full lunch that is portion controlled and definitely neatly packed!
